Materials That Make a Statement

The products utilized in fireplace building and construction considerably affect their beauty and design. Here's a breakdown of popular materials that can raise the aesthetic of your fireplace.

  1. Marble: Known for its elegant appearance, marble can turn any fireplace into a focal point.
  2. Granite: Durable and available in different colors, granite includes a contemporary touch to traditional styles.
  3. Wood: Classic and warm, wooden mantels can be handcrafted for a distinct appearance.
  4. Glass: For a contemporary feel, glass can be utilized to create a fireplace that mixes perfectly with contemporary interiors.
  5. Brick: A standard choice, brick can be painted or left in its natural state to match various aesthetics.
ProductAdvantagesDrawbacks
MarbleGlamorous, DurableCostly, Heavy
GraniteModern, Various ColorsCan chip, Heavy
WoodWarm, CustomizableProne to fire damage, Needs upkeep
GlassSleek, ContemporaryDelicate, Requires mindful cleaning
BrickTraditional, InsulatingCan be difficult to clean, Heavy

Functions That Add Elegance

In addition to style and product, certain features can improve the elegance of a fireplace. Think about the following:

  1. Mantels: A beautifully crafted mantel can frame the fireplace and include a focal point to the room.
  2. Fireplace Surrounds: Custom surrounds made from stone, tile, or metal can raise the overall design.
  3. Lighting: Integrated lighting can highlight the fireplace as a focal point, adding mood and heat.
  4. Screens and Tools: Elegant screens and toolsets not only serve a useful function but can likewise match the overall aesthetic.
FunctionPurposeInfluence on Elegance
MantelsFraming the fireplaceCreates visual focus
Fireplace SurroundsEnhancing the styleAdds texture and color
LightingHighlighting the fireplaceSets the state of mind
Screens and ToolsSecurity and accessibilityComplements the style
